About SkyLand Ranch

Overview

SkyLand Ranch tickets offer flexible ways to experience this mountaintop attraction in Sevierville, including general admission with scenic chairlift access, the Wild Stallion Mountain Coaster, or a combination of both. Enjoy live entertainment, miniature animal encounters, dining, and Smoky Mountain views across the ranch's 100-acre property.

Good To Know

  • Scenic Skyride Chairlift offers panoramic views of the Smoky Mountains, Sevierville, and Pigeon Forge.
  • Ride the 1.25-mile Wild Stallion Coaster—over 8 minutes long; available as a standalone or combo ticket.
  • Enjoy live music, multiple dining options, boutique shops, and close-up encounters with miniature animals.
  • Admission is valid for 3 consecutive days and includes the Buckaroo Playbarn for kids.
  • Kids ages 2 and under enter free.
  • Wild Stallion riders must be 3+ years old and 38" tall; those under 54" must ride with an adult.
  • Free guest parking is available on-site.

Description

Explore SkyLand Ranch, a mountaintop attraction in Sevierville where Smoky Mountain views meet family-friendly fun. Spread across 100 acres, the ranch gives you space to ride, eat, explore, and unwind at your own pace.

Ride to the mountaintop on the Horizon Skyride chairlift and take in scenic views along the way. At the top, SkyLand Ranch features a western-themed village with walkable outdoor spaces, live entertainment, miniature animal encounters, shops, dining spots, and shaded seating.

SkyLand Ranch is also home to the Wild Stallion Mountain Coaster, the longest mountain coaster in the Southeast with more than a mile of track. Control your own speed as you wind downhill through sweeping turns and open scenic sections.

Get up close with miniature animal encounters throughout the ranch, including miniature horses, highland cows, goats, and alpacas. Keep an eye out for the SkyLand Ranch Longhorns while exploring the grounds.

Frequently Asked Questions about SkyLand Ranch

Where is SkyLand Ranch?

SkyLand Ranch is located across from the Tanger Outlets at 1620 Parkway in Sevierville, TN, right off the main Parkway.

How long should I plan to spend at SkyLand Ranch?

Most guests spend several hours enjoying the Skyride, coaster, food, shops, and live entertainment. With a 3-day ticket, you can return and explore at a relaxed pace.

Is SkyLand Ranch suitable for young children?

Absolutely! Attractions like the Buckaroo Playbarn and Safari Hayride are designed for younger guests.

Is SkyLand Ranch wheelchair accessible?

Yes, the ranch offers several wheelchair-accessible attractions and amenities. However, some experiences—such as the Wild Stallion Mountain Coaster—may have specific physical requirements. The Horizon Skyride chairlift is accessible to guests who are able to stand while loading and unloading, as wheelchairs and other mobility devices are not permitted on the lift. These items may be checked at the SkyLand Ranch office located at the base of the chairlift. Complimentary wheelchairs are available near the top of the lift for guest use.

Is there parking available?

Yes, free parking is available for all guests and included with every ticket, making your visit convenient from the moment you arrive.

What should I bring?

Comfortable shoes, weather-appropriate clothing, and a camera for those breathtaking views! Be sure to check ride requirements if planning to ride the coaster.

Can I ride the Skyride more than once?

The Horizon Skyride provides access to and from the mountaintop, and can be used during your 3-day admission. A shuttle is also available if preferred.

Are there alternative transportation options to the Horizon Skyride?

Yes, guests can opt for shuttles or an open-air safari truck to reach the top of the ranch.

Is the Wild Stallion Mountain Coaster included in general admission?

No, the coaster requires a separate ticket. Combo tickets are available for both general admission and the coaster.

Can kids ride the coaster alone?

Children must be at least 3 years old and 38” tall. Riders under 54” must be accompanied by an adult.

Are there dining options available on-site?

Yes, guests can enjoy meals at the SkyLand Café & Bakery or choose from various food trucks in The Backyard area.
